- Make sure your details are up-to-date with SARS: Before you try the SMS method, it's crucial to ensure that SARS has your correct contact information. This includes your registered cellphone number. If you've changed your number and haven't updated it with SARS, this method won't work. You can update your details through the SARS eFiling portal or by visiting a SARS branch.
- Send the SMS: Once you've confirmed your details, simply send an SMS to SARS with the word "Tax Number" to 47277. Make sure you type it correctly! This is a premium rated service, so you will be charged a fee for sending the SMS.
- Wait for the response: After sending the SMS, you should receive a reply from SARS containing your tax number. This usually happens within a few minutes, but it could take a bit longer depending on network traffic. Be patient, and your number should arrive shortly.
- Register for eFiling: If you haven't already, you'll need to register for SARS eFiling. Go to the SARS eFiling website (www.sarsefiling.co.za) and follow the instructions to create an account. You'll need to provide some personal information and create a username and password.
- Log in to eFiling: Once you've registered, log in to your eFiling account using your username and password.
- Request Tax Number: Once logged in, navigate to your profile. Look for an option such as "Request Tax Number" or "Tax Status. The exact wording might vary slightly, but it should be easy to find.
- Download the Confirmation: SARS will then display your tax number. There should be an option to download a confirmation letter or a similar document that includes your tax number. Download this document and save it to your computer.
- Visiting a SARS Branch: You can visit your nearest SARS branch in person and request your tax number. Make sure to bring your ID and any other relevant documents. Be prepared to wait in line, as SARS branches can get quite busy.
- Contacting the SARS Contact Centre: You can call the SARS Contact Centre and speak to a representative who can help you retrieve your tax number. Have your ID number and other personal information ready for verification.

Getting Your SARS Tax Number via SMS
One of the quickest and easiest ways to get your SARS tax number is through SMS. This is super convenient if you need the number on the go and don't have access to a computer. Here’s how you can do it:
There are a couple of important things to keep in mind when using the SMS method. Firstly, you need to send the SMS from the cellphone number that is registered with SARS. If you send it from a different number, SARS won't be able to verify your identity, and you won't receive your tax number. Secondly, be aware that this is a premium rated service, so you'll be charged for sending the SMS. The exact cost will depend on your mobile network provider, so it's a good idea to check with them beforehand. Despite these considerations, the SMS method is generally a quick and convenient way to get your SARS tax number, especially if you need it urgently and don't have access to other methods.

Protecting your SARS tax number is essential to prevent identity theft and fraud. Identity theft occurs when someone uses your personal information, such as your tax number, to impersonate you and commit fraudulent activities. This can include opening bank accounts in your name, applying for loans, or filing fraudulent tax returns. If your tax number falls into the wrong hands, you could become a victim of identity theft and suffer significant financial and personal harm. Therefore, it's crucial to take steps to safeguard your tax number and other personal information. One way to do this is to be cautious of phishing scams. Phishing scams are fraudulent attempts to obtain your personal information by disguising as a legitimate organization, such as SARS or your bank. These scams often involve sending emails or text messages that ask you to provide your tax number or other sensitive information. SARS will never ask for your tax number or other sensitive information via email or phone, so if you receive such a request, it's likely a scam. Always be wary of suspicious emails or phone calls and never provide your personal information unless you're sure that the request is legitimate. Another way to protect your tax number is to store it securely. Avoid storing your tax number on your phone or in an unencrypted email, as these methods are not secure. Instead, keep your tax number in a safe place, such as a password-protected file on your computer or a secure document at home. Additionally, be careful about who you share your tax number with. Only provide your tax number when it's absolutely necessary and be wary of anyone who asks for your tax number without a legitimate reason. By taking these steps, you can help to protect your tax number and prevent identity theft and fraud.
